With his signature blend of history, insider reporting, sharp opinion, and vivid anecdote, Peter King offers an extraordinary front-row-seat chronicle of the modern NFL, taking us into the defining moments, teams, controversies, and more.

Brief description: Peter King wrote for Sports Illustrated from 1989 to 2018, including the weekly multiple-page column "Monday Morning Quarterback." He is the author of five books, including Inside the Helmet. He has been named National Sportswriter of the Year three times. He lives in Brooklyn, New York.
